Columbus Circle K Sells $2 Million Powerball Ticket

COLUMBUS, OH – A lucky individual who played the Powerball game at Circle K #5268 in Columbus on Saturday night won $2 million. The ticket matched 5-of-5 numbers but missed the Powerball, landing the game’s second-tier prize.

The winning numbers for the draw were 30, 36, 49, 52, 63 with Powerball 16, and a Power Play of 5. The fortunate ticket holder now has 180 days to claim their winnings. Additionally, Circle K #5268, located at 5499 Hall Road, will receive a $1,000 bonus for selling the winning ticket
